sistemas operativos

Páginas: 13 (3073 palabras) Publicado: 23 de agosto de 2013

Un sistema operativo es el software q controla el funcionamiento global de un ordenador. Se proporciona el medio por el cual, un usuario puede almacenar y recuperar archivos, proporciona la interfaz grafica mediante la cual un usuario puede solicitar la ejecución de programas.
Historia de los sistemas operativos
Los sistemas operativos son grandes paquetes de software complejos, losordenaros de los años 1940 y 1950 no fueron muy flexibles. Las maquinas ocupaban habitaciones enteras.
La ejecución de cada programa, llamado un puesto de trabajo, era un hecho aislado a la actividad de la maquina. El programa fue ejecutado, y a continuación todas las cintas de, tarjetas perforadas, etc. Tuvieron que ser extraídos antes de la próxima preparación del programa podía. Cuando variosusuarios necesitaban compartir una maquina, se daban hojas de inscripción, para que los usuarios la pudieran reservar la maquina por bloques de tiempo, la maquina era bajo el control de ese usuario.
En dicho entorno los sistemas operativos comenzaron como sistemas para simplificar la configuración y para agilizar la transición entre puestos de trabajo. Un desarrollo fue la separación de losusuarios y de equipos , lo cual elimino la física transición, de las personas dentro y fuera de la sala de ordenadores, un operador de la computadora fue contratado, para operar la maquina.
Este fue el inicio de procesos por lotes, la ejecución de puestos de trabajo de su recogida en el único lote. En los sistemas de procesamiento por lotes, los puestos de trabajo que residen en una espera dealmacenamiento masivo para la ejecución en una cola de trabajos.
La mayoría de colas de trabajo, no lo hacen con rigor de seguir la estructura FIFO, ya que la mayoría de los sistemas operativos, proporcionan para su consideración las prioridades de trabajo. Como resultado un trabajo en espera en la cola de trabajos puede ser un golpeado por un trabajo de mayor prioridad. Cada puesto de trabajo fueacompañado por un conjunto de de instrucciones que explican los pasos necesarios, para preparar la máquina para un trabajo en particular.
Cuando el trabajo fue seleccionado para su ejecución, el sistema operativo imprime estas instrucciones, en la impresora en donde podrían ser leídos y seguidos por el equipo operador.
Un gran inconveniente de usar un operador de la computadora como unintermediario, entre un ordenador y sus usuarios es que los usuarios no tienen interacción con sus puestos de trabajo
Para adaptarse a estas necesidades, los nuevos sistemas operativos, que se desarrollaron pidió , permitió que un programa que se ejecuta para llevar a cabo un dialogo con el usuario a travez de terminales remotas(una terminal consistía en poco más de una máquina de escribir electrónicapara que el usuario podría escribir la entrada de y leer la respuesta del equipo que fue impreso en el papel . hoy terminales se han convertido en dispositivo más sofisticados llamados estaciones de trabajo, incluso en ordenadores completos que pueden funcionar como equipos independientes cuando se desee) de suma importancia para el procesamiento interactivo del éxito.
El equipo está obligadoa ejecutar las tareas en virtud de un plazo, un proceso que se conoce como, procesamiento del tiempo real en la que las acciones realizadas se produce en tiempo real. Pero las computadoras de las décadas entre 1969 y 1970 eran caras, por lo que cada máquina tenía que servir para más de un usuario. Si el sistema operativo insistido en la ejecución de un solo trabajo a la vez, solo un usuariorecibiría satisfactoriamente el tiempo real de servicio .
La solución a este problema fue diseñar sistemas operativos que proporcionaron servicio a varios usuarios al miso tiempo: una característica denominada de tiempo compartido es aplicar la técnica llamada de , multiprogramación, en que el tiempo se divide a intervalos y luego la ejecución de cada trabajo se limita a solo un intervalo a la...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Sistema Operativo Y Tipos De Sistemas Operativos
  • Atomicidad de operaciones
  • operaciones basicas del sistema operativo
  • Sistemas Operativos
  • Sistema operativo
  • Sistema operativo
  • Sistemas operativos
  • Sistema Operativo

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S